MEROVINGIAN GOLD RING WITH GARNET CABOCHON
Ca. AD 400 - 600 A Merovingian gold ring with an angular hoop and with a D section that enlarges on the shoulders to form an oval bezel. The oval bezel secures a large oval red garnet cabochon. For similar see: El Legado de Hefesto, n. 287.
Size: D:18.34mm / US: 8 1/4 / UK: Q; Weight: 5.82g
